To relieve distress amongst parents and
families who have suffered a paediatric
death in particular but not exclusively by
the provision of gowns, items for
bereavement rcoms, cuddle blankets and
such other support as the trustees may
from time to time detennine.
We have worked with a number of
hospitals. supplying hand casling kits,
cooling blanketslcots, bereavement books
for use in a mortuary setting and also to
help understand and navigate grief,
bedding and hospital gownslbaby grows
(mortuary). We have worked with
Maccelsfield, Leighton and resupplied
previous hospf(als during 2024-2025 lax
ear.
